Food Scientist
New School Foods (powered by NS/TX) · Toronto
Job description
About the role
We are seeking a talented Food Scientist to join our fast‑growing team. The successful candidate will apply deep knowledge of food ingredient chemistry—particularly hydrocolloids, starches, and plant proteins—to develop innovative meat‑analog products with superior nutrition, flavor, appearance, and texture.
Key responsibilities
- Support the innovation pipeline from brainstorming and concept development through commercialization, ensuring compliance with food safety standards.
- Improve existing formulations to enhance organoleptic properties, texture, nutritional profile, and cooking performance.
- Design, execute, and document experiments; analyze data using statistical tools.
- Characterize hydrocolloid‑starch‑protein interactions and conduct high‑throughput screening and shelf‑life studies.
- Operate and maintain laboratory equipment such as texture analyzers and colorimeters.
- Assist in product scale‑up, define specifications, and troubleshoot production issues.
- Collaborate with regulatory, QA, and production teams; contribute to patents, scientific papers, and presentations.
Required profile
- Bachelor’s degree in food science, chemistry, material science, engineering, or a related discipline.
- 5+ years of product development experience in a food or food‑ingredient company.
- 3+ years of hands‑on experience in food formulation, ingredient functionality, process design, and commercialization.
- Proven experience in texture development, emulsion formulation, and scale‑up testing.
Required skills
- Hydrocolloid, starch, and plant‑protein interaction characterization.
- Texture analysis, rheology, and colorimetry.
- Statistical analysis and data interpretation.
- High‑throughput screening and shelf‑life testing.
- Laboratory equipment operation and maintenance.
